sp_show_statistics_steps (SQL Server Compact)

Хранимая процедура sp_show_statistics_steps возвращает гистограмму, в которой представлена текущая статистика распределения для указанного индекса в указанной таблице.

Синтаксис

sp_show_statistics_steps 'table_name' , 'index_name'

Аргументы

  • table_name
    Имя таблицы, содержащей индекс.

  • index_name
    Имя индекса, по которому требуется статистика.

Результирующий набор

В таблице приводится описание столбцов, возвращаемых в результирующем наборе.

Имя столбца

Описание

RANGE_HI_KEY

Верхнее предельное значение шага гистограммы.

RANGE_ROWS

Число строк образца, попадающих в каждый шаг гистограммы, за исключением верхнего предельного значения.

EQ_ROWS

Число строк образца, которые равны по значению верхнему предельному значению шага гистограммы.

DISTINCT_RANGE_ROWS

Число неопределенных значений в шаге гистограммы, за исключением верхнего предельного значения.

Замечания

Возвращенные результаты отражают избирательность индекса. Низкая плотность указывает на более высокую избирательность. На основе результатов можно определить, насколько полезен индекс для оптимизатора запросов.

Пример

В следующем примере выводятся статистические данные для индекса Employees_PK в таблице Employees.

sp_show_statistics_steps 'Employees', 'Employees_PK'

См. также

Справочник

sp_show_statistics (SQL Server Compact)

sp_show_statistics_columns (SQL Server Compact)

Другие ресурсы

Повышение производительности (SQL Server Compact)